Default 403 to 416.

well i was going to go with a 403 but changing my mind to a 416 its only $200 more. so my set up is going to be 416 with about 11.0 to 1 comp, Trick flow ls 225, ported fast 92, 92 TB, yella terra rockers, 36lb inject, undrive pulley, electic water pump. the only question i got is i have a 2000 Trans Am is the MAF is stock will that be alright??????

with an engine that size, I woud guess your going with a fast intake setup, to get the best power. Your stock MAF unit will choke you down, I have a 383 and mine was maxed out. I went with the 100mm TSP unit, it is super nice and will be more than enuff, you will have to get it all tuned in, but since you are swappin engines you should have it tuned anyways.
